Output 98859724a123e1fa1850ddb7404afa0683a06df11c23d1d921f5fd8923aa48ff:0

value
4917950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 486c73af533f190ffa6efa702c7aee30a68d4a0d OP_EQUAL
address
38HxVj1yH7dn8WGhQpX1Rdkn9FbkWt1nC6
transaction
98859724a123e1fa1850ddb7404afa0683a06df11c23d1d921f5fd8923aa48ff
spent
true